Leon Bradford Obituary

Janesville, WI - Leon G. Bradford, 88, of Janesville, WI, passed away on Friday, September 12, 2025 at SSM Hospital, Janesville. Leon was born in Janesville, WI on September 30, 1936 to the late George H. and Helen (Lasher) Bradford. He graduated from Janesville High School. He enlisted in the Navy. On November 16, 1956, Leon married Rose Goldsmith. Leon worked for many years as a carpenter and handy man.

Leon is survived by his children: Cindy (Lance) Witt of Edgerton, WI, Bill (Judy) Bradford of Edgerton, WI; grandchildren: Corrine, Alex, Arie; great-grandchildren: Lexie, Deonica, Xander, Ava, Aydin, Holden; great-grandchildren: Layla. He was preceded in death by his parents; wife: Rose Bradford; and a brother: Willard Bradford.

Memorial services will be held at 11 AM on Friday, October 10, 2025 at Fulton Church. Visitation will be held on Friday at the church from 10 AM until the start of services. Albrecht Funeral Homes, Edgerton are assisting the family. www.albrechtfuneralhomes.com
